Shellsburg Police Chief Marty Evans and Councilman Phillip Travis met with the board and the sheriff to discuss a possible contract for partial law enforcement coverage in Shellsburg. Evans explained that Shellsburg was interested in entering into an agreement with Benton County for law enforcement coverage on an as-needed basis. Evans stated that coverage is needed during periods of officer absences, as well as allowing for twenty-four hour coverage when the Shellsburg police department is unavailable due to scheduling and other situations. Sheriff Forsyth stated that he had no concerns with providing the service; however he questioned what the fees would be for the coverage. The discussion included the current contract with the City of Urbana and if a similar contract could be drafted with Shellsburg. Moved by Vermedahl, seconded by Sanders, to request that the sheriff draft an agreement for consideration by the supervisors to provide law enforcement coverage to the City of Shellsburg to assist them as needed to provide twenty-four hour coverage or during periods of scheduled and unscheduled departmental absences. All members voting aye thereon. Motion carried.

Moved by Vermedahl, seconded by Sanders, to enter into a contract with Tyler Technologies for the purchase the Version X financial software program. The cost of the program is $56,323.00 plus travel expenses. The annual subscription is $14,823.00. The annual subscription price is locked in for a period of five years. All members voting aye thereon. Motion carried.
The board discussed the building housing the Department of Human Services personnel. The board has researched moving the offices to a different location or repairing the current facility. Supervisor Sanders voiced concern as to whether it was the best use of county funds to repair the facility and make it more functional versus renting another facility and selling the current building. Supervisor Vermedahl also had concerns but indicated that there were not viable options at this time and that repairs needed to be done to the existing building. Supervisor Buch echoed Vermedahl’s position. The Board indicated that action to repair the current facility should proceed.
